What is Secret Scanning?

Also known as: Secret Detection · Credential Scanning · 시크릿 스캐닝 · 시크릿 탐지 · 크리덴셜 스캐닝 · 시크릿 검출

The process of automatically searching code repositories, CI logs, container images, SaaS documents, chat transcripts, and other locations for accidentally committed credentials. Modern secret scanning goes beyond regex (which produces noise) to use entropy analysis, contextual parsing, and provider-specific validators that prove a leaked key is actually live before paging the owner.
